II. Market size and growth trend
(I) Market size
In 2025, the global LEGO brick market size is about US$11.03 billion. This huge market covers all consumer groups from children to adults, as well as a variety of application scenarios from entertainment to education. LEGO bricks occupy an important position in the global toy market with its strong brand influence and continuously innovative product lines.
(II) Growth trend
It is expected that from 2025 to 2034, the global LEGO brick market will continue to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.26%, and the market size will reach US$16.05 billion by 2034. This growth trend is mainly due to the following aspects:
The rise of emerging markets: The growing middle class in emerging markets such as the Asia-Pacific region and Latin America has led to an increasing demand for high-quality Educational Toys, providing a broad space for the growth of the LEGO brick market.
Expansion of the education market: With the global emphasis on STEM education, the educational value of LEGO bricks has become increasingly prominent. More and more schools and educational institutions have incorporated them into teaching tools, driving the market demand for educational LEGO bricks.
Product innovation and IP cooperation: The LEGO Group continues to launch innovative products and co-branded sets with popular IPs (such as Star Wars, Marvel, Harry Potter, etc.), attracting a large number of consumers' attention and purchases.
Expansion of online sales channels: The rapid development of e-commerce has enabled LEGO bricks to reach global consumers more conveniently, and online sales have continued to grow.

III. Market drivers
(I) Prominence of educational value
LEGO bricks have significant educational value in cultivating children's creativity, logical thinking ability, spatial imagination and hands-on ability. With the continuous updating of global education concepts, more and more parents and educators have realized the important role of toys in children's growth. Lego bricks, as a toy that is both entertaining and educational, have been widely welcomed. According to a survey, 45% of parents cite educational value as one of the main reasons for buying Lego bricks.
(II) IP cooperation and brand influence
The Lego Group has launched a series of attractive joint products through cooperation with many well-known IPs. For example, the series of sets launched in cooperation with Star Wars not only attracted the attention of Star Wars fans, but also further enhanced the influence of Lego bricks among adult consumers. In addition, Lego's own brand image is also deeply rooted in the hearts of the people, and its strong brand loyalty makes consumers more willing to choose Lego products.
(III) Expansion of online sales channels
The rise of e-commerce has provided a new channel for the sales of Lego bricks. Consumers can easily purchase Lego bricks through platforms such as Amazon and Lego's official website. The convenience and breadth of online sales channels enable Lego bricks to reach global consumers more quickly. In addition, online platforms often launch various promotional activities, which further stimulate consumers' desire to buy.
(IV) Trend of sustainable development
Against the backdrop of growing environmental awareness, the LEGO Group is actively promoting sustainable development. In 2024, the LEGO Group announced that half of the raw materials it purchased came from sustainable sources. This move not only meets the global consumer demand for environmentally friendly products, but also enhances the image of the LEGO brand and attracts more consumers who focus on sustainable development.

IV. Market segmentation
(I) Product types
The product types of LEGO blocks are rich and diverse, mainly including the following:
Basic sets: Basic sets are traditional products of LEGO blocks, containing standard Building Blocks of various shapes and colors. This type of product does not have a specific theme or assembly instructions, and is designed to inspire children's creativity and imagination, allowing them to play freely and build a variety of unique works.
Theme sets: Theme sets are a major feature of LEGO blocks, and they usually have a specific theme or story background. For example, Star Wars theme sets, Harry Potter theme sets, Marvel theme sets, etc. These theme sets not only contain detailed assembly instructions, but also attract a large number of fans to buy through cooperation with well-known IPs.
Educational sets: Educational sets are products designed for schools and educational institutions. These sets usually contain components related to STEM education, such as robot kits, programming modules, etc. They are designed to cultivate students' science, technology, engineering and mathematics abilities through fun assembly and programming activities.
(II) Application fields
The application fields of LEGO bricks are wide, covering many aspects such as home entertainment, educational institutions, and commercial activities:
Family entertainment: LEGO bricks are an ideal choice for family entertainment. Both children and adults can relax, cultivate creativity and parent-child interaction by assembling LEGO bricks.
Educational institutions: In the field of education, LEGO bricks are widely used in STEM education courses in schools. Educational sets can help students better understand and master complex scientific and mathematical concepts, while cultivating their hands-on ability and teamwork spirit.
